Acute Care: Clinical Cross-Section 2023

Injuries, infections, interventions, inborn errors of metabolism, and more! This edition in PNCB's popular series for acute care, Acute Care: Clinical Cross-Section 2023, offers a variety of topics to keep your practice knowledge agile for children with a range of special conditions. Content will support you to:

  • Evaluate and discuss the treatment of traumatic craniomaxillofacial injuries and recognize emergencies in hematologic and oncologic disorders and in children who are technology dependent.
  • Diagnose organic acidemias and other inborn errors of metabolism and anticipate appropriate treatment strategies.
  • Explore cranial disorders, including Chiari malformations and advanced monitoring technologies for neurologic injuries.
  • Identify infectious diseases including emerging and re-emerging infections, meningitis, and neonatal sepsis, and prescribe appropriate anti-infective therapies.
  • Explain the pathophysiology, adverse effects, and interventions for acute liver failure in children.
  • Describe noninvasive and invasive respiratory modalities for children with neuromuscular diseases.

This module is available for $85, and is worth 7.5 contact hours upon completion.
